The Ultimate Guide to Choosing the Best Ice Packs for Knee Surgery Recovery
Knee surgery can be tough. You need rest and care to heal. One of the most helpful tools for recovery is an ice pack. It helps reduce swelling and pain. But not all ice packs are the same. This guide will help you pick the best one for your needs.
Key Features to Look For
1. Size and Shape
Your ice pack should fit your knee well. A pack that’s too small won’t cover the whole sore area. A pack that’s too big might be awkward to use. Look for packs that are long and wide enough to wrap around your knee. Some packs have special shapes that hug your knee better.
2. Flexibility
When frozen, some ice packs get very hard. This makes them uncomfortable to use. You want an ice pack that stays a little soft even when frozen. This allows it to mold to your knee and reach all the sore spots. Flexible packs offer better pain relief.
3. Durability
You’ll use your ice pack a lot. It needs to be strong. Check for thick materials that won’t leak easily. A well-made ice pack will last through your whole recovery and maybe even longer.
4. Ease of Use
How easy is it to freeze and use the pack? Some packs just go in the freezer. Others might need special preparation. You want something simple. It should be easy to clean too.
5. Reusability
You’ll need ice packs for a while. Reusable packs save you money. They are also better for the environment. Most good ice packs are designed to be used many times.
Important Materials
Gel Packs
Many ice packs use a special gel inside. This gel stays cold for a long time. It also stays flexible when frozen. This makes gel packs very popular. They are usually made of a strong plastic outer layer. This layer holds the gel in.
Fabric Covers
Some ice packs come with a fabric cover. This cover is important. It stops the ice pack from freezing your skin. It also makes the pack more comfortable to hold. Look for soft, breathable fabrics.

User Experience and Use Cases
How People Use Ice Packs After Knee Surgery:
Most people use ice packs several times a day. They often do this for the first few days or weeks after surgery. It’s a key part of managing pain and swelling. You can put the ice pack on your knee for 15-20 minutes at a time. Then, you take a break for about 20 minutes before icing again.
Some ice packs have straps. These straps help keep the pack in place. This is useful when you are moving around a bit. You can ice your knee while sitting or even lying down. The fabric cover makes it comfortable against your skin. It feels soothing and helps you relax.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Ice Packs for Knee Surgery
Q: What is the main purpose of an ice pack after knee surgery?
A: The main purpose is to reduce swelling and pain in your knee. It helps your knee heal.
Q: How long should I ice my knee after surgery?
A: You should ice your knee for 15-20 minutes at a time. Take a break for about 20 minutes between icing sessions.
Q: How often should I use an ice pack?
A: You can use it several times a day, especially in the first few days and weeks after surgery. Your doctor will give you specific advice.
Q: Can I put the ice pack directly on my skin?
A: No, you should not. Always use a fabric cover or a towel between the ice pack and your skin to prevent frostbite.
Q: What is the best type of ice pack for knee surgery?
A: Gel packs are often recommended because they stay flexible and cold for a good amount of time.
Q: How do I clean an ice pack?
A: Most gel packs can be wiped clean with mild soap and water. Check the product instructions for specific cleaning advice.
Q: Can I use a bag of frozen peas instead of an ice pack?
A: While frozen peas can offer some cold therapy, a dedicated ice pack is usually better. Ice packs are designed to stay cold longer and mold to your knee more effectively.
Q: How long does an ice pack stay cold?
A: This varies by product, but good quality ice packs can stay cold for 20-30 minutes or longer.
Q: Should I freeze my ice pack solid?
A: For flexible gel packs, it’s best to freeze them until they are firm but still a little pliable. This allows them to conform to your knee.
Q: Are there ice packs with straps?
A: Yes, some ice packs come with straps. These help keep the pack securely in place on your knee.
